When turning power down, it's best to roll into the throttle and if EGT is too high (or too much total fueling) let off the throttle to let boost come down, adjust the knob below where you think it needs to be say 1/2 turn down, then turn the knob 1/4 turn up (so total change is 1/4 turn down (counterclockwise). The action of going too far downward and adding tension by going back up a little resets the internal regulator function and allows the unit to function properly. Then roll into the throttle and see if the fueling level is acceptable. If fueling is still too high, let off and repeat the same turn down/turn up process. If fueling is less than desired, simply add a little more fuel with a slow clockwise turn on the red power knob. Increased power settings can be changed at full throttle/boosted conditions. Decreased power setting changes work best when no or very low boost is present. Once the max fueling is set, then work on the smaller black knob to create a fueling curve. A good starting point for the black knob is turned all the way in clockwise, then back out one full turn. I like to make response/smoke/fuel curve adjustments 1/4 turn at a time.
Also, the max travel spring kits are rated by typical boost range they are used, not the actual boost pressure required for maximum travel. The 35 to 45 psi spring goes full travel in the 28 to 30 psi range. If you have a nice turned up pump from Seth, and you're building a towing truck, I'd expect reasonable towing settings to occur in the 15 to 20 psi AFC pressure range.

Also, a heavier AFC spring can be used if you'd like more resolution in your tuning settings meaning if you want the largest range from minimum to maximum fueling vs. AFC pressure, install a heavier AFC spring.

For my personal daily driver, I run our 30-35 psi spring because it creates a more aggressive fuel curve in full power mode when I want it, and with the "tuned-mode" settings, I can still slowdown the fuel curve and limit maximum fueling enough to be street friendly. Back before AFC LIVE, I used to run an old 160 pump governor spring that didn't allow full travel till almost 55 psi. While this worked reasonably well to create a fuel curve, it was too heavy of a spring more towing at times where it would hit a wall where it couldn't accelerate and couldn't boost more boost right around the 20psi total boost range. When running unloaded, this wasn't an issue because the truck could slowly push through the "flat spot". The only solution when loaded was to slide the AFC further forward to move this "flat spot" higher up in the boost range where it wouldn't get stuck in 3rd lockup on a big hill. The slid forward AFC position would result in uncontrollable bottom end smoke that could only be controlled with less aggressive throttle application. With AFC LIVE and the old 55 psi governor spring, the same flat spot existed so the only way to cure the issue was a lighter AFC spring.

So on my 98' daily driver, Farrell maxed 215 pump, 5x020 injectors, K27/472sxe compounds, I run the 30-35 psi spring which goes full travel at 26 psi boost. When empty I've tuned max AFC pressure to 21psi and smoke control knob is 1.25 turns counter clockwise from fully closed. When I tow my race truck/trailer 16k total gross weight, I turn the max AFC pressure to 15 psi with the Red fuel knob and turn the smoke control knob to 1 turn CCW from fully closed. When I tow Todd's 6k race truck on his 7.5k Backhoe trailer 21k total gross weight, I turn max AFC pressure to 12 psi with the Red fuel knob and smoke control knob is just less than 1 turn CCW from fully closed.
